一探可编程逻辑控制器的技术深度与操作指南 (可编程逻辑器件实验)

一探可编程逻辑控制器的技术深度与操作指南 可编程逻辑器件实验

一、引言

可编程逻辑控制器(PLC,Programmable Logic Controller)作为一种重要的工业控制装置,广泛应用于机械制造、汽车、化工、食品饮料、环保等多个领域。
PLC具有强大的功能,可实现各种复杂的控制逻辑,如顺序控制、运动控制、数据处理等。
本文将深入探讨PLC的技术深度,并为大家提供一份详细的操作指南。

二、可编程逻辑控制器(PLC)技术深度解析

1. PLC基本构成

PLC主要由CPU、存储器、输入输出接口、电源模块等构成。
其中,CPU是PLC的核心,负责执行存储在其内部的程序;存储器用于存储程序和数据;输入输出接口用于连接外部设备,实现数据交换;电源模块为PLC提供稳定的工作电压。

2. PLC工作原理

PLC采用循环扫描的工作方式,包括输入采样、程序执行和输出刷新三个阶段。
在输入采样阶段,PLC读取输入状态和数据;在程序执行阶段,PLC按照既定的程序进行逻辑运算;在输出刷新阶段,PLC根据运算结果更新输出状态。

3. PLC编程语言

PLC支持多种编程语言,如梯形图(LD)、指令表(IL)、顺序功能流程图(SFC)等。
其中,梯形图是最常用的编程语言,具有直观、易懂、易学的特点。

4. PLC功能特点

PLC具有可靠性高、抗干扰能力强、组合灵活、编程方便等特点。
PLC还支持模块化设计,可根据实际需求进行扩展。

三、可编程逻辑控制器(PLC)操作指南

1. PLC硬件连接

(1)确认电源:确保PLC的电源模块连接正确,提供稳定的工作电压。

(2)连接输入输出设备:通过输入输出接口连接外部设备,如传感器、执行器等。

(3)通信端口连接:根据需要,连接PLC的通信端口,如以太网、串口等。

2. PLC软件编程

(1)选择合适的编程语言:根据实际需求选择合适的编程语言进行编程。

(2)编写控制程序:根据控制要求,编写相应的控制程序。

(3)调试程序:在模拟环境中调试程序,确保程序的正确性。

(4)上传程序:将编写好的程序上传到PLC中。

3. PLC操作注意事项

(1)遵守安全规范:在操作PLC时,应遵守相关的安全规范,确保人身安全。

(2)熟悉操作手册:熟悉PLC的操作手册,了解各功能模块的详细操作。

(3)备份程序:在修改或上传程序前,应备份原程序,以防意外损失。

(4)定期维护:定期对PLC进行维护,确保其稳定运行。

四、可编程逻辑器件实验

1. 实验目的

通过实验,了解PLC的工作原理、功能特点,掌握PLC的编程方法和操作技巧。

2. 实验内容

(1)PLC基本组成及工作原理实验;

(2)PLC编程语言及编程实验;

(3)PLC控制外部设备实验;

(4)PLC数据处理及通信实验。

3. 实验步骤

(1)搭建实验环境:连接PLC硬件,配置实验环境;

(2)进行基本实验:完成PLC基本组成及工作原理实验;

(3)编程实践:选择适当的编程语言,编写控制程序;

(4)实验验证:连接外部设备,验证控制程序的正确性;

(5)数据处理及通信实验:进行数据处理和通信实验,了解PLC的数据处理能力和通信功能。

五、结语

本文详细介绍了可编程逻辑控制器(PLC)的技术深度和操作指南,希望能对广大工程师和技术人员有所帮助。
在实际应用中,应根据具体需求选择合适的PLC型号和编程方式,遵循操作规范,确保PLC的稳定运行。


可编程逻辑器件实验内容简介

本书内容详尽,分为三个主要章节,分别是eda6000/eda2000实验开发系统、基础实验和综合实验的深入探讨。 在附录部分,特别针对Xilinx开发环境的使用技巧进行了详尽讲解。 全书内容涵盖了广泛的实践环节,包括运用原理图编辑输入法和vhdl、verilog HDL文本编辑输入法进行数字电路和系统设计实验的设计。 每个实验的设计过程严谨有序,从输入编辑、编译,到仿真验证,再到引脚锁定和最终的编程下载,一步到位,目标是将实验设计的电路成功下载到FPGA或CPLD目标芯片中。 实验环节在eda6000或eda2000实验平台上进行,为读者提供了硬件验证的实战环境。 每个实验都精心设计了思考题,旨在激发读者的独立思考和动手实践能力,鼓励他们在完成实验的同时,也能自我探索和深化理解。

EDA与可编程实验教程内容简介

本书分为三个章节,旨在提供全面的实验学习体验。 首先,第一章聚焦于数字信号处理(DSP)实验。 这里深入探讨了数字信号处理器(DSP)芯片,包括其独特的硬件结构,以及如何使用汇编语言进行编程。 我们还将介绍DSP软件开发的方法与过程,以及如何在CCS环境中操作和实践。

第二章转向CPLD/FPGA实验,通过Altera公司的CPLD/FPGA的详细介绍,帮助读者深入理解可编程逻辑器件。 章节中穿插实用的软件介绍和工程实例,使学习者能够准确掌握EDA(电子设计自动化)技术,轻松上手实践。

第三章关注自动控制领域,以CPMlAO为样机,探讨PLC(可编程逻辑控制器)控制系统的设计。 计算机辅助编程的广泛应用在这里得以体现,特别提及了OMRON的CX-P窗口编程软件,其友好的人机界面和易操作性,使得学习过程更加直观和高效。

本书实验内容丰富多样,每个章节从基础到深入,层次分明,紧跟时代发展。 无论是大专院校在校生还是相关专业人员,都能从中找到适合的学习材料和参考资源,是一本极具实用价值的实验指导书籍。

可编程逻辑器件及EDA技术图书目录

可编程逻辑器件及EDA技术图书目录概览

本书分为多个章节,详细探讨了可编程逻辑器件和EDA技术的基础与应用。 首先,第1章概述了EDA技术的主要特征和设计方法,介绍了从ASIC到FPGA和CPLD等不同类型的可编程逻辑器件,以及它们的设计流程和主流开发工具,如Xilinx的ISE和Altera的QuartusⅡ。 此外,还讨论了器件的选型原则和IP核的基础知识,以及EDA技术的发展趋势。

在第2章,读者将学习VHDL硬件描述语言,这是设计可编程逻辑器件的通用语言。 章节介绍了VHDL的结构、基本要素,如标识符、数据对象和语句,以及其在组合逻辑和时序逻辑电路设计中的应用实例。

第3章至第4章,通过一系列典型设计实例,深入展示了如何用VHDL设计组合逻辑电路、时序逻辑电路,以及数字系统如数码管显示、乘法器、除法器、CPU和交通信号灯控制器等。 第5章则专门讲解了QuartusⅡ7.0开发系统的使用,包括设计输入、综合与编程、仿真和逻辑分析等步骤。

第6章介绍了SOPC系统,包括其技术概述、处理器选择、开发工具,以及不同FPGA器件对SOPC的支持。 第7章至第10章进一步深入探讨NiosⅡ嵌入式处理器、外设、系统设计以及一体化EDA开发工具的使用。

最后,参考文献部分列出了书籍和资料的来源,供读者进一步学习和研究。 通过阅读本书,读者将获得全面的可编程逻辑器件和EDA技术知识,为实际项目设计打下坚实基础。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论